Mental Health Assessment Tool Kit: A Comprehensive Guide
Mental health is a vital element of general well-being, yet it often stays neglected in both personal and professional spheres. To resolve this growing concern, a psychologically healthy society needs effective assessment tools to identify, measure, and monitor mental health issues. A Mental Health Assessment Tool Kit can provide people and healthcare professionals with the resources required for recognizing mental health conditions, helping with treatment, and promoting preventive strategies.
What is a Mental Health Assessment Tool Kit?
A mental health assessment tool kit - https://www.cristopherwohlrab.top/health/the-importance-of-private-mental-health-treatment - is a compilation of numerous tools, resources, and guides designed to assist evaluate mental health status. These tool kits can be used by mental health specialists, teachers, employers, or anybody thinking about comprehending mental health much better. They often include questionnaires, diagnostic criteria, screening tools, and more to assess psychological conditions such as depression, anxiety, PTSD, and other mental health disorders.
Secret Components of a Mental Health Assessment Tool Kit
Screening Tools
Screening tools normally include standardized questionnaires that assess particular mental health conditions. They supply an initial evaluation and contribute in recognizing signs that may require further assessment.

Examples of Screening Tools:
Patient Health Questionnaire-9 (PHQ-9) for depressionGeneralized Anxiety Disorder-7 (GAD-7) for anxietyPTSD Checklist for DSM-5 (PCL-5) for post-traumatic stress disorder
Diagnostic Criteria
Diagnostic criteria based on standardized guidelines like the DSM-5 (Diagnostic and Statistical Manual of Mental Disorders) help mental health specialists make informed diagnoses. This ensures that the assessments are constant and rooted in recognized medical practices.

Self-Assessment Resources
Self-assessment resources empower individuals to review their mental health. These might consist of journals, worksheets, or interactive tools that guide individuals through a self-evaluation process.

Details Guides
Educational products to enhance understanding of mental health problems. These guides might cover subjects such as coping mechanisms, treatments, and the significance of early intervention.

Recommendation Resources
A list of regional mental health services and emergency support resources enables timely intervention. This is critical for people who may need more professional support.

Mental health tool sets are important for a number of reasons:
